Abstract
We show that in the class of Lindelöf Čech-complete spaces the property of being C-embedded is quite well-behaved. It admits a useful characterization that can be used to show that products and perfect preimages of C-embedded spaces are again C-embedded. We also show that both properties, Lindelöf and Čech-complete, are needed in the product result.
